Could you foster a dog until they find their forever home?

  • April 5, 2017
  • News
  • Greece

Network for Animals has recently begun looking for homes for some of the dogs we work with around the world. You might have seen us call out for homes for dogs like Pandelis and Olympia, two of thousands of dogs in difficult situations who deserve our love.

As well as helping dogs find their forever homes, we are also looking for individuals and families to start fostering dogs. You might be able to look after one of our dogs for a little while, or help give a dog a home temporarily, but not forever.

Foster families help us to feel confident that we can rehome dogs from different countries, knowing that there are lots of options for a dog. Fostering also helps us to get to know dogs so we can make the best decisions about where they might best fit. It allows us to take our time rehoming dogs, rather than rushing the process and risking a dog being unhappy with their forever family.
